繁体   English   中英

BIRT:基于本地报告参数过滤级联的报告参数组

[英]BIRT : Filter cascaded Report Parameter group based on Local Report Parameter

我想设计BIRT报告,以便在我的情况下,用户将输入开始时间和停止时间,基于开始时间和停止时间,我将获得在开始时间和停止时间之间存在的可用批次名称的列表。 然后,用户将从组合框中选择批次名称以查看详细信息。 我已尝试使用级联报告参数组,但是基于开始时间和停止时间的报告参数批处理列表未得到过滤。

我不知道您的Birt版本是什么,但是,您可以为此使用级联参数,请尝试:我假设您有2或3个数据集:一个(或两个)获取开始时间和结束时间,另一个一个获得您的批次名称。 创建新的级联参数时,请选择多个数据集: 在此处输入图片说明

然后,使用创建的数据集添加两个参数:开始时间和结束时间。然后,对于批次名称,创建另一个数据集,例如:

在此处输入图片说明

然后,留在数据集中,进入“参数”选项卡,并添加您想要的两个参数:

在此处输入图片说明

这应该工作

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M